REPORT: Jerome Tang fired as Head Basketball Coach at K-State
Multiple reports indicate that Jerome Tang has been dismissed as head coach at Kansas State University following Sunday’s 78-64 loss to Houston Cougars men’s basketball. The defeat dropped the Wildcats to 1-11 in Big 12 Conference play and marked their sixth straight loss. The move came one game after a 91-62 home loss to Cincinnati

Burke becomes winningest coach in Skidmore men’s basketball history
With Saturday’s 101-94 victory over Hobart College, Skidmore College men’s basketball head coach Joe Burke became the program’s all-time wins leader, earning his 215th career victory.
